Preparing for Your Man and Van Booking
A little preparation can make your move faster and more cost-effective. Even if you are only moving a few items, having things ready before the van arrives helps avoid delays and makes the process smoother.
Preparation checklist
- Pack boxes securely and label them clearly
- Separate fragile items and mark them carefully
- Empty drawers and shelves where needed
- Measure large furniture for doors, stairs, and lifts
- Reserve parking if that is possible for your property
- Notify building management if access is limited
- Keep keys, documents, and valuables with you
- Disassemble items only if agreed in advance
If you live in a flat near a busy road, parking and loading arrangements may need a bit of planning. If you are moving from an estate or a block with shared access, letting the mover know about entry codes, loading bays, or lift restrictions helps the job run on time.
Good preparation saves time and reduces the chance of confusion on the day. Even simple steps, such as clearly separating items that are staying from items that are going, can make a noticeable difference.
Pricing Factors: What Affects the Cost?
Customers often want to know what influences the cost of a man and van service in Merton. Exact prices vary from job to job, but the main factors are usually straightforward.
Typical pricing factors include
- Volume of items – a few boxes cost less to move than a full flat of furniture
- Distance travelled – local Merton moves may differ from longer journeys across London
- Time required – the number of hours involved in loading, driving, and unloading
- Access difficulty – stairs, narrow entrances, and parking issues can affect labour time
- Extra handling – dismantling, reassembly, or moving heavy awkward items may take longer
- Multiple stops – collections from more than one address may require additional time
It is always better to describe the job accurately when requesting a quote. If you are unsure whether everything will fit in one vehicle, list the larger pieces and mention any special items. That helps the service provider plan the right vehicle size and time allocation.
Transparent booking information is useful for both sides. It reduces surprises on moving day and helps you compare the right service level for the type of move you need.
